The invention relates to a vehicle battery abnormity identification method and device, a vehicle and a storage medium, and the method comprises the steps: collecting the charging parameters and driving information of the vehicle, carrying out the travel division, obtaining a division result, updating the historical accumulated data of the vehicle, obtaining the updated accumulated data, and obtaining at least one group of parameter judgment threshold values of the vehicle, and obtaining at least one normal working range interval of the vehicle battery based on the at least one group of parameter judgment threshold values, so as to judge whether each parameter in the charging parameters is in the at least one normal working range interval or not, and if at least one parameter is not in the corresponding normal working range interval, judging whether the vehicle battery is in the normal working range interval or not. A vehicle battery is determined to be in an abnormal state. According to the embodiment of the invention, the abnormal state of the vehicle battery can be effectively identified by calculating the parameter judgment threshold and dynamically generating the judgment standard of the battery parameter, the identification accuracy is high, the driving safety and the driving stability of the vehicle are guaranteed, and the use experience of a user is improved.
